Features of the disease

The tumor formed in the nasopharynx can be of two types:

  • Benign;
  • Malignant.

To a benign carry:

  • Angiofibroma;
  • Hemangioma.

Benign education is rare, most often it is diagnosed in children (it can be congenital). But the malignant tumor of the nasopharynx is the problem of people aged, in most cases - men.

Symptoms

How does nasopharyngeal cancer manifest itself? Symptoms of this tumor appear already in the early stages. The reason is that the nasopharynx is considerably limited by the bones, and this leads to a squeezing of the tumor, which only begins to develop.

Symptoms of cancer of the nose and nasopharynx are similar:

  • Permanent nasal congestion (reminiscent of allergic rhinitis or common colds, but no other signs anymore);
  • From the nose appear purulent discharge, sometimes with impurities of blood.

Nasopharyngeal and pharyngeal cancer are symptoms that can indicate both one and the other disease:

  • Painful sensations during eating, and even when swallowing saliva;
  • Paroxysmal cough;
  • Hoarseness of voice;
  • Constant discomfort in the mouth;
  • Change voice timbre.

Other signs:

  • Hearing impairment;
  • Problems with speech;
  • Periodic bifurcation in the eyes;
  • headache.

In later stages, the body weight begins to decrease, and the cervical lymph nodes increase.

Diagnostics

The examination begins when the patient has treated with characteristic signs. One of the main symptoms is an increase in the cervical lymph nodes. Sometimes this symptom is unique in nasopharyngeal cancer.

The doctor first of all pays attention to:

  • Signs that the patient is talking about;
  • Numbness of the skin;
  • Condition of lymph nodes.

Due to the deep location of the nasopharynx, it can not be visually inspected without auxiliary instruments. There are cases when the tumor is located under the mucous membrane, which requires a biopsy.

Diagnostic methods that must be used to establish an accurate diagnosis:

  1. X-rays of light. This examination is necessary in order to exclude metastases in the lungs.
  2. CT and MRI. The doctor can examine the tumor in detail.
  3. Biopsy. With the help of a puncture, tissues are taken for examination.
  4. Blood test. Helps determine if there are any accompanying pathologies in the body.

Treatment

Therapy is selected individually, depending on the stage of the disease. The age of the patient, his general state of health is taken into account. Basic methods:

  • radiation therapy;
  • chemotherapy;
  • operation.

Radiation therapy

This method of treatment is considered the main one. In the initial stages, only radiation therapy is used, and at later stages it is combined with other methods of treatment, in the frequency with chemotherapy. The principle of action is irradiation of the tumor and nearby tissues.

Radiation therapy affects cancer cells and slows their growth. When the irradiation was carried out, further further procedures for prevention are shown to the patient. After all, sometimes in the lymph nodes remain particles of metastases. They can not be considered because they are too small.

The disadvantage of this method of treatment is that it affects not only the bad cells, but also the general state of human health. Radiation therapy is used before and after surgery.

Chemotherapy

With this method of treatment, the tumor cells are suppressed and destroyed. The doctor prescribes cytotoxic drugs that perform their work from the inside.

Chemotherapy is combined with other treatments. But, as a rule, it is prescribed before the radiation therapy and after the operation. The goal is to completely destroy the tumor cells in all tissues.

Operation

Surgical intervention is aimed at removal:

  • Remnants of a tumor;
  • Enlarged lymph nodes.

If the tumor does not spread to other organs, surgery should not cause any difficulties during work. If the metastases were found in other organs, the surgeon will excise a part of the injured organ.
